What to fill in
| Field | What to enter | Example |
|---|---|---|
| Parties and destination | Identify the supplier, overseas buyer, delivery address and destination country accurately. | Example Exporter, Pune → Sample Buyer, Singapore |
| Currency | State one agreed invoice currency. These example files use INR and do not convert currencies. | INR |
| Goods and shipping reference | Use verified descriptions, classification, quantity and relevant shipment references. | Two sample components; actual HSN |
| Export endorsement | Select the full endorsement applicable to the real tax route; do not combine IGST-payment and bond/LUT alternatives. | Review the actual payment-of-tax or bond/LUT route |
Match the invoice to the actual shipment
An export invoice connects the buyer, goods, value and destination. The worked example uses INR so there is no hidden exchange-rate calculation. Confirm the real commercial currency, contract and shipping information before editing a document for use.
Choose the applicable export route
The displayed endorsement illustrates a hypothetical bond/LUT transaction without payment of integrated tax. A transaction under a different route requires the corresponding verified wording and tax treatment. The example does not establish LUT validity or eligibility.
Keep shipping and official processes separate
These downloads do not generate a shipping bill, certificate of origin, packing list, customs filing, IRN or official QR code. An invoice may be one part of the shipment documentation; confirm requirements with the relevant professional or authority.
- Check the buyer, consignee, delivery address and destination country.
- Record the actual items, classification, quantities and agreed currency.
- Select and review the applicable tax treatment and endorsement.
- Reconcile the invoice with the packing, contract and shipment records.

Goods export, services export and domestic supply
| Scenario | Useful identifying detail | Separate review |
|---|---|---|
| Goods example in these files | Two components, HSN, quantity and destination | Shipment documentation and applicable export route |
| Services example: remote design work | One agreed design milestone, SAC and overseas customer details | Whether the actual services meet the applicable export conditions |
| Domestic supply | Domestic customer, supply location and item details | Use the appropriate domestic invoice and tax treatment |
For a manual services example, one approved design milestone at INR 5,000 gives INR 5,000 before any separately reviewed tax treatment. An overseas customer name alone does not determine export eligibility.
Common questions
Can I change INR to another currency?
The Word layout can be edited manually, but you must change every relevant currency label and check all amounts. No conversion or exchange-rate rule is supplied.
Is every export eligible for the displayed LUT wording?
No. The wording is a conditional example, not an eligibility decision. Review the actual route and documentation.
Will customs accept this download?
No acceptance is guaranteed. Requirements depend on the shipment and jurisdiction; the template does not submit or validate documents.
